Abstract
This paper introduced the influence of vehicle dynamics of the drive mode about the independent drive eight in- wheel electric vehicle. The influence with four typical driver modes was analyzed in detail base on the vehicle dynamics simulation model, such as the 8 × 8, 8 × 6, 8 × 4 and 8 × 2 modes. Combined with three kinds of typical working condition, the models for dynamic performance of the vehicle impact were verified. Simulation results show that the drive model should be selected by the slip action on the base of the vehicle safety. This strategy can better play to the advantages of 8 in-wheel independent drive.
